How To Get Free Shift Code in Borderlands 4

borderlands 4 credits
It might take some time. Credit to 2K

You can earn a free Shift Code in Borderlands 4 once you finish the game.

We’ve blurred out the code above, but rest assured that’s a full-length Shift Code used to redeem a Golden Key. We didn’t say it would be the quickest method in the world to secure a Shift Key—but it is a free one!

But yes, once you finish Borderlands 4 for the first time, you’re rewarded with a Shift Code.

We can’t confirm if you get one every time you beat the game, which would be a lot of work just for a second key. Regardless, once you beat the main story, chances are you might have more content to mop up anyway, and the inevitable New Game Plus playthrough to take on.

What Do Shift Codes Do in Borderlands 4?

Shift Codes need to be redeemed to secure a Golden Key in Borderlands 4—and these are consumable items which reward you with super-special weapons and goodies.

Borderlands is known for its ‘Golden Chest’, which can only be opened with Golden Keys. You can go back to Borderlands 2 and the Golden Chest sitting in the middle of the town. It was a cool feeling when you had Golden Keys to waste on new loot.

Borderlands 4 retains this system, and you can presumably redeem Shift Codes through the in-game Social feature—just like in previous Borderlands games.
